The U.S. Embassy in Mexico has issued guidance to Americans headed to Mexico over the winter months, encouraging them to be conscious of the nation’s present Level 2 journey advisory and urging them to “exercise increased caution” on account of “terrorism, crime, and kidnapping.”

The embassy shared recommendation for planning protected journey earlier this month, together with “following the entry and exit requirements, reviewing local laws, and other travel guidance from the U.S. embassy or consulate.”

The Level 2 advisory — outlined on the official State Department journey web site — applies to 17 Mexican states and notes that violent crimes embrace “homicide, kidnapping, carjacking, and robbery.”

“There is a risk of terrorist violence, including terrorist attacks and other activity in Mexico,” it provides.

Seven states together with Baja California, Chiapas, Chihuahua, Guanajuato, Jalisco, Morelos, and Sonora have a Level 3 advisory, which implies Americans ought to “reconsider travel.” Six states — Colima, Guerrero, Michoacan, Sinaloa, Tamaulipas, Zacatecas — have Level 4 advisories, indicating that Americans mustn’t journey there.

The State Department web site reminds vacationers that it has “limited ability to help in many parts of Mexico,” and authorities workers aren’t allowed to journey to sure high-risk areas.

Due to the aforementioned safety dangers, Americans are inspired to “follow the same restrictions as U.S. government employees while traveling to Mexico.”

Emergency companies are restricted or unavailable in distant or rural areas.

“If you encounter a road checkpoint, you should comply. Fleeing or ignoring instructions can lead to you being hurt or killed,” the State Department web site reads.

What to learn about Mexico Level 2 Travel Advisory

Thousands of Americans go to Mexico through the winter months, in response to the embassy. As such, vacationers ought to contemplate the next:

Crime: “Crime, including violent crime, can occur anywhere in Mexico, including in popular tourist and expatriate destinations,” the embassy said.

Popular winter break locations the place U.S. vacationers ought to train warning, in response to the embassy, embrace San Carlos, Puerto Peñasco (Rocky Point), Los Cabos, and Mazatlán, amongst others, “especially after dark.”

Firearms and different weapons: “Bringing firearms or ammunition into Mexico without proper local permits and permissions is a serious crime that can lead to a lengthy prison sentence,” the embassy said. “All guns and even small amounts of ammunition, used shells, empty magazines, knives, fireworks and explosives, daggers, swords, and brass knuckles are illegal.”

Entry and exit necessities:

All vacationers should acquire a Forma Migratoria Múltiple, or FMM, which individuals can apply for on-line or at an area immigration workplace. It presently prices round $47, however will enhance to $54 beginning January 2026. This doc is required to go away Mexico and ought to be stored in a protected place whereas touring.

Immigration:

All vacationers to Mexico want a passport guide or card to enter Mexico, the embassy famous. Minors should have a legitimate U.S. passport guide when touring domestically in Mexico by air.

Upon arrival, Mexican immigration authorities will decide how lengthy a traveler is allowed to remain, in response to the embassy.

“Pay attention to the date written on your entry stamp. Violating the terms of your stay in Mexico can result in fines and detention,” it said. “Ensure your passport is valid for the duration of your stay.”

Legal and customs entry: “Know Mexican customs and laws on items you are allowed to bring into Mexico,” the embassy said. “If touring by automotive, make sure you adjust to Mexico’s temporary vehicle import law.”

See a full listing of Mexican customs and laws here to seek out out which objects are allowed into Mexico.

Cash of $10,000 or extra have to be declared when coming into Mexico, as should items value greater than $300 when arriving by land, or $500 for anybody arriving by air.

Drugs:“Drug possession and use, including medical marijuana, is illegal in Mexico and may result in a lengthy jail sentence,” the embassy said.

Additionally, it stated, “Mexican cartels, criminal organizations and terrorist organizations are active in a violent struggle to control trafficking routes. U.S. citizens should not carry packages across the border for them.”

Actions Americans can take whereas touring to Mexico

The embassy additionally reminded vacationers to make sure they put together accordingly in the event that they plan to journey to Mexico this winter.

Travelers ought to make sure you test the State Department Travel Information Pageand the Mexico Travel Advisory for particulars and entry necessities and enroll within the Smart Traveler Enrollment Program, or STEP, for security updates and data on how one can get assist in an emergency from the embassy or consulate.

Travelers also needs to maintain their passport and FMM entry allow in a protected place, and ensure the date by which they need to depart Mexico.

The embassy suggested vacationers to name 911 in an emergency.

“Although there may be English-speaking operators available, it is best to seek the assistance of a Spanish speaker to place the call,” it said. “If you need roadside assistance on a Mexican federal toll highway, call the Green Angels by dialing 078 from a phone in Mexico or by calling 911.”

Those touring to Mexico ought to test their medical health insurance protection or buy journey insurance coverage. “Seek coverage that includes medical evacuation. Confirm costs of medical treatment in advance, when possible,” the embassy stated.

Travelers ought to make sure you additionally inform household and pals about any journey plans — particularly if they’re touring solo — and share copies of their passport and automobile registration “with a trusted contact in the U.S.,” the embassy famous.

Mexico’s Tourist Assistance line might be reached at 078 from any cellphone in Mexico. Multilingual Centers for the Care and Protection of the Tourist, in addition to Tourist Assistance Centers can be found for disputes with companies and the federal government, to file legal reviews, or for different particular wants, in response to the embassy.

Travelers ought to contact the U.S. Embassy in Mexico or consulate if in want of help.
